Abstract
The invention discloses a screw loosening agent, which comprises the following components in part by weight: 60 to 80 parts of hydrocarbon refrigerant, 10 to 25 parts of hydrocarbon solvent oil, 3 to 5 parts of synthetic ester and 5 to 10 parts of sulfonate rust inhibitor, wherein the hydrocarbon refrigerant is R-433b or tetrafluoroethane HFC-R134a or a mixture of the R-433b and tetrafluoroethane HFC-R134a; the hydrocarbon solvent oil is one or a mixture of C10 to C16 alkane; the synthetic ester is trimethylolpropane; and the sulfonate rust inhibitor is sulfonate. In the invention, according to the principle of expansion and contraction, a fastener which is rusted and cannot be loosened is subjected to flash freezing in a detachment process to make a required gap between structural members bonded into a whole due to rust corrosion, so that the solvent oil, synthetic ester, sulfonate and the like, which are sprayed out together with the refrigerant, can permeate into the gap for derusting and lubricating; and thus, both the fastener and the structural members get necessary repair and the loosening of the screw is realized naturally.

Background technology
With the closely-related railway of social development, bridge, electric wire steelwork, vehicle and all kinds of factories and miness machineries etc., main fixedly connected between member with screw.In daily laid-up operation, the fastening pieces such as screw that corrosion can't be become flexible are used always ways processing such as machine oil immersion, the oxygen blast of acid material burn into, sawing.Waste time and energy and the cost height, efficient is low.At present, existing screw loosening agent product is sold on the market, for construction brings convenience.But since raw materials used mostly be have infiltration, derust, the industrial raw material of lubrication, it is more expensive to exist product price, the speed of becoming flexible screw waits shortcoming more slowly, it is applied be restricted.

Ultimate principle of the present invention is the principle of expanding with heat and contracting with cold that utilizes people to know; In unloading process, earlier the fastening piece that can't become flexible because of corrosion is given anxious freezing; Make it compelled shrink by force, make and produce necessary gap between the structural part that is bonded into one because of corrosion, realized rust cleaning and lubricated in the slit so the solvent oil that sprays simultaneously with refrigeration agent, synthetic ester, sulphonate etc. penetrate into immediately; Make fastening piece and structural part all obtain necessary reparation, so far loosening the becoming of screw must.

In the material that the present invention adopts, sulphonate has detergent-dispersant additive class speciality, is alkalescence, calcium contents is high, and is peace and quiet effective to greasy filth; R433b is environmental protection refrigerant and also has certain lubricity; HFC-R134a is an environmental protection refrigerant; Trihydroxy-propane oleic acid ester belongs to the polyol ester class, and thermotolerance is better, and sticking warm nature is good, and lubricity is outstanding, and is not volatile, is normally used for metalworking fluid and preparation medium; C
10~C
16Alkane is oiliness, is used to lubricate.
